Description

Udon noodles with a spicy Peanut sauce.

Ingredients
  • 1 (9 ounce) package dried udon noodles
  • ½ cup chicken broth
  • 1 ½ tablespoons minced fresh ginger root
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 3 tablespoons peanut butter
  • 1 ½ tablespoons honey
  • 2 teaspoons chili oil
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 whole rotisserie chicken, skinned and boned, meat pulled into large chunks
  • 1 red bell pepper, thinly sliced
  • ¼ cup green onions, chopped
  • ¼ cup chopped peanuts
  • ¼ cup chopped fresh cilantro
Directions
  1. 1. Bring a large pot with lightly salted water to a rolling boil. Drop the udon in a few noodles at a time and return to a boil. Cook uncovered, stirring occasionally, until the pasta has cooked through, but is still firm to the bite, 10 to 12 minutes. Drain; return to the pot.
  2. 2. While the udon noodles are cooking, whisk the chicken broth, ginger, soy sauce, peanut butter, honey, chile oil, and garlic in a saucepan over medium-high heat. Bring to a boil, whisking until the peanut butter has melted. Pour the sauce over the noodles. Add the chicken and red bell pepper; toss until the noodles are evenly coated in the sauce. Sprinkle with green onions, chopped peanuts, and cilantro to serve.
